Noun [Ancient Greek]

IPA: /ó.kʰos/, /ˈo.xos/, /ˈo.xos/, /ó.kʰos/ (note: 5ᵗʰ BCE Attic), /ˈo.kʰos/ (note: 1ˢᵗ CE Egyptian), /ˈo.xos/ (note: 4ᵗʰ CE Koine), /ˈo.xos/ (note: 10ᵗʰ CE Byzantine), /ˈo.xos/ (note: 15ᵗʰ CE Constantinopolitan)
Etymology: From Proto-Hellenic *wókʰos, from Proto-Indo-European *wóǵʰos, from *weǵʰ- (“to move, drive”). Cognates include Mycenaean Greek 𐀺𐀏 (wo-ka /⁠wokʰa⁠/, “vehicle”), Sanskrit वाह (vā́ha), Old Church Slavonic возъ (vozŭ). Also see ὀχέω (okhéō, “to carry”) and Arcadocypriot Greek ϝέχω (wékhō, “to carry, bear”).
